1. MySQL简介
MySQL是一个开源的关系型数据库管理系统(RDBMS),由MySQL AB公司开发,后被Oracle公司收购。它以体积小、速度快、成本低且开放源码而著称,被广泛应用于网页应用和小型企业系统中。MySQL支持多种操作系统平台,并提供了包括SQL语句在内的多种接口。
2. 关系数据库管理系统 (RDBMS)
关系数据库是将数据组织成一系列的表,每个表包含行和列。表之间可以通过外键建立关系,使得数据能够以结构化的方式存储和管理。RDBMS允许用户通过SQL(Structured Query Language)来操作这些数据。
3. MySQL使用的SQL语言
SQL是与MySQL交互的主要方式,用于执行如创建、查询、更新和删除数据等操作:
- SELECT:用于从数据库中检索数据。
- INSERT:用于向表中插入新记录。
- UPDATE:用于修改现有记录。
- DELETE:用于删除记录。
- CREATE:用于创建新的数据库或表。
- ALTER:用于修改现有的数据库或表结构。
- DROP:用于删除数据库或表。
4. MySQL数据处理
- 数据定义语言 (DDL):用于定义数据库结构,比如创建表 (
CREATE TABLE
)、修改表 (ALTER TABLE
)、删除表 (DROP TABLE
) 等。 - 数据操作语言 (DML):用于操作表中的数据,比如插入 (
INSERT
)、更新 (UPDATE
)、删除 (DELETE
) 数据。 - 数据查询语言 (DQL):主要是
SELECT
语句,用于从数据库中检索数据。 - 数据控制语言 (DCL):用于管理权限和安全,如
GRANT
和REVOKE
语句,用于分配和撤销用户权限。
第二步:MySQL的安装
虽然具体步骤可能因操作系统而异,但一般过程如下:
- 下载安装包:访问MySQL官方网站或通过包管理器(如Linux的apt或yum)获取适合您操作系统的安装包。
- 安装过程:双击运行安装程序,根据提示进行安装设置。您可能需要选择安装类型(服务器、客户端、开发者等)、指定安装路径以及设置root用户的密码。
- 配置MySQL服务:安装完成后,可能需要配置MySQL服务为开机启动,并确保服务已经启动。
- 测试安装:通过命令行工具(如mysql命令)尝试连接MySQL服务器,使用默认的root用户和安装时设定的密码进行登录。